# Settings for the Stockmend reconciliation job.
# Plugin authors: your hooks run after the diff pass, so don't
# mutate counts mid-cycle or the ledger math goes sideways.
# Batch size and retry knobs live further down; defaults are sane.
# The job needs direct access to the inventory database, which
# it reads from the value on the next line.

primary connection of yagep-kahip = redis://giliel_svc:zYiKsLL2PLpfPL@db-348f.xolmarsys.corp:5432/fenwyn

## Changelog — Ticktrace 1.9

### Renamed: DRIFT_API_TOKEN
During the cron drift investigation we found plugins confusing this variable with the metrics token, so it has been renamed to indicate it authorizes drift-report uploads specifically. Plugin authors must read the new name from 1.9 onward; the old name is ignored without warning. Sample env files in the SDK are updated. In your deployment env file, the drift-report upload secret is set on the next line.

env line for fawef-taguf: VAULT_KEY13=a9695905a9a90

### Runbook: Report export timezone mismatches (Glimmerfield)

If a customer reports that exported totals differ from the dashboard, check whether their report schedule predates the March cutover — older schedules still render in server-local time rather than the account timezone. Re-saving the schedule fixes it. Before escalating, confirm the export worker is running with the expected timezone settings shown below.

config for kadup-kajog:
[raldor]
host = raldor.tolvaqworks.internal
user = raldor_svc
database = raldor_prod